Anti-Israel protesters donned Benjamin Netanyahu masks and smeared their hands with fake blood for a Sunday sit-in against the Israeli prime minister in Washington.
Activists led by the radical CODEPINK group demonstrated outside the pro-Israel AIPAC lobbys annual conference at the Walter E. Washington Convention Center.
In addition to the masks, many protesters wore black-and-white keffiyeh scarves to give themselves a distinctly Arab look.
The protesters were expected to return Monday, when Netanyahu is scheduled to address the conference.
Netanyahu who opposes a pending nuclear deal with Iran is in the United States for a scheduled Tuesday address to Congress.
